Responsibilities

~1 min read

As a Locum Psychologist, you will:

  • Conduct specialist psychological assessments and develop evidence-based formulations.
  • Deliver individual and group psychological interventions tailored to service user needs.
  • Work collaboratively with psychiatrists, nurses, occupational therapists and other members of the multidisciplinary team.
  • Contribute to risk assessments, care planning and review meetings.
  • Support psychologically informed practice across the service.
  • Provide consultation and guidance to colleagues where appropriate.
  •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ation in line with professional standards.
  • Participate in service development and quality improvement initiatives.

Requirements

~1 min read

  • HCPC registration as a Clinical, Counselling or Forensic Psychologist.
  • Doctoral-level qualification in Psychology (or recognised equivalent).
  • Experience working with adults with complex mental health needs.
  • Strong assessment, formulation and intervention skills.
  • Ability to work effectively within a multidisciplinary team.
  • Previous experience within inpatient mental health, rehabilitation or secure services.
  • Experience facilitating therapeutic groups.
  • Knowledge of trauma-informed approaches.
  • Experience contributing to service development or staff consultation.
